YouTube is rolling out Communities to allow creators to engage their fans directly on the platform, reducing reliance on external platforms for interaction.
Communities function like a blend of forums and groups, enabling creators to share posts, images, and facilitate discussions among fans.
YouTube has developed a new Community Hub to centralize activity management for creators, combining comments and interactions to streamline fan engagement.
Despite efforts to enhance interaction, Communities may lead to complex moderation challenges as fans can contribute their own content rather than just comments.
